On Thu, May 09, 2019 at 09:54:14AM -0700, Zubin Mithra wrote:
> Hello,
> 
> Syzkaller has triggered a lockdep warning when fuzzing a 4.4 kernel with the following stacktrace.
> 
> Call Trace:
>  [<ffffffff81cb9fad>] __dump_stack lib/dump_stack.c:15 [inline]
>  [<ffffffff81cb9fad>] dump_stack+0xc1/0x124 lib/dump_stack.c:51
>  [<ffffffff813eceac>] print_circular_bug.cold.51+0x1bd/0x27d kernel/locking/lockdep.c:1226
>  [<ffffffff81207f1a>] check_prev_add kernel/locking/lockdep.c:1853 [inline]
>  [<ffffffff81207f1a>] check_prevs_add kernel/locking/lockdep.c:1958 [inline]
>  [<ffffffff81207f1a>] validate_chain kernel/locking/lockdep.c:2144 [inline]
>  [<ffffffff81207f1a>] __lock_acquire+0x38da/0x52a0 kernel/locking/lockdep.c:3213
>  [<ffffffff8120b0be>] lock_acquire+0x15e/0x440 kernel/locking/lockdep.c:3592
>  [<ffffffff82a53056>] __mutex_lock_common kernel/locking/mutex.c:624 [inline]
>  [<ffffffff82a53056>] mutex_lock_nested+0xc6/0x10b0 kernel/locking/mutex.c:744
>  [<ffffffff822e186c>] rtnl_lock+0x1c/0x20 net/core/rtnetlink.c:70
>  [<ffffffff828ae743>] ipv6_sock_mc_close+0x113/0x350 net/ipv6/mcast.c:288
>  [<ffffffff82875f06>] do_ipv6_setsockopt.isra.12+0xce6/0x2cc0 net/ipv6/ipv6_sockglue.c:202
>  [<ffffffff82877f7c>] ipv6_setsockopt+0x9c/0x130 net/ipv6/ipv6_sockglue.c:905
>  [<ffffffff828863af>] udpv6_setsockopt+0x4f/0x90 net/ipv6/udp.c:1436
>  [<ffffffff82250fef>] sock_common_setsockopt+0x9f/0xe0 net/core/sock.c:2693
>  [<ffffffff8224e223>] SYSC_setsockopt net/socket.c:1780 [inline]
>  [<ffffffff8224e223>] SyS_setsockopt+0x163/0x250 net/socket.c:1759
>  [<ffffffff82a5f267>] entry_SYSCALL_64_fastpath+0x1e/0xa0
> 
> Could the following patch be applied in order to v4.4.y? This patch is present in
> linux-4.9.y.
> * 8651be8f14a1 ("ipv6: fix a potential deadlock in do_ipv6_setsockopt()")
> 
> Tests run:
> * Chrome OS tryjobs
> * Syzkaller reproducer

Now queued up, thanks.
